KUALA LUMPUR: Companies should consider it “a kind of national service” if they form a consortium to clean and beautify Sungai Bunos, Sungai Gombak and Sungai Klang which flow through the heart of the city.
“It will be an entirely private sector initiative. I am sure the companies will not mind contributing towards making the rivers, and Kuala Lumpur in general, clean and beautiful again,” said Datuk Seri Abdullah Ahmad Badawi told reporters after launching a book called Kuala Lumpur, Corporate Capital Cultural Cornucopia at the Islamic Arts Museum here yesterday.
